## Ticket: Config drift in Fathomgrid formula sandbox

Production and staging sandboxes have diverged: staging permits longer evaluation timeouts and a larger allowed-function set. Plugin authors testing against staging may ship formulas that fail in production. We are realigning both environments this week. Until then, validate against the production values. The authoritative production sandbox configuration is:

service settings:
[casax]
port = 6379
team = rusir
host = casax.zemvarhq.corp
region = outer-4
access_code = ac_9808ce
timeout_ms = 1500

## Support

The Corvalyn component library follows strict semantic versioning. Breaking changes to props, slots, or emitted events always land in a major release, and deprecations are announced one minor version in advance with console warnings. Reviewers should verify that changelog entries match the version bump in each pull request. If you spot a mismatch or an undocumented breaking change, contact the library stewards.

escalation mailbox, bafog-fafog: ulador@paliqlabs.internal

## Onboarding: Farebranch Rules Engine

Plugin authors integrate with Farebranch by registering fee rules against the evaluation API. Rules are sandboxed; they cannot perform network calls directly. All rate-table lookups go through the host, which validates your plugin manifest at load time. Your local env file must include the signing credential the host uses to verify manifests, set on the next line.

secret setting of bajef-fajof: COURIER_KEY3=76c

# GarageGlance Environments

Quick refresher for reviewers: the occupancy feed runs in three environments — sandbox, staging, and prod. Sandbox fakes the sensor data, staging reads from the Pinewood Deck test garage, and prod is the real thing. If a diff touches polling or cache TTLs, sanity-check against the current values shown here.

deployment values, kajep-kageg:
[praix]
host = praix.paliqcorp.corp
user = praix_svc
database = praix_prod